Lavelle Cossey White, 93, of Savannah, passed away from this life on Monday, July 15, surrounded by her loved ones. She was born on Sept. 3, 1930, to William and Ruth Hodges Cossey.
On Oct. 23, 1948, she was united in marriage to Harold Vernon White, who preceded his wife in death on March 27, 1995.
Lavelle was a lifetime resident of Savannah, Tennessee, and a member of New Pleasant Grove Freewill Baptist Church. She worked at Brown Shoe and Angelica. Lavelle enjoyed sewing and loved spending time with her children and grandchildren. She was a selfless soul and would always help anyone in need.
In addition to her parents and husband, she was preceded in death by her daughter, Mackie Adams; granddaughter, Beth White; five brothers; and four sisters.
She is survived by her sons, Larry (Carol) White and Keith White; nine grandchildren; 24 great-grandchildren; and 17 great-great grandchildren.
Memorial services were held on Friday, July 19, at Shackelford Funeral Directors of Savannah, with Carlos Hughes and Anthony Franks officiating. Burial followed at White’s Creek Cemetery in Savannah.
